I have a question for you all (I dont post much, but I do read all

the posts)...

How do you manage no shows for consults? I am in a small private

practice (myself and one other IBCLC), I do all of the office and

paperwork and 95% of the consults and pump rentals as she has a

hospital job and I am availiable much more often. We do home visit

consults as well as consults here in the office. Our business has

been up and running about 1 year now and I was certified in 2006,

been a LLL Leader for 8 years...so still fairly new at this!!

So far when I have had a mom call to make an appointment I have just

taken down her info (name, phone, address) and set up a time to see

her. Moms who request a home visit and then change thier minds call

me as they obviously dont want me showing up on thier doorstep. But

the office consults are becoming a problem as many of these moms

never show up. It is a pain for me for a variety of reasons as I

have blocked out that time and therefore have lost business by not

accepting any other appointments and rentals during that time, and of

course I am upset that I have also lost that persons business as well.

So, my question is: do any of you take a deposit or ask for a credit

card number to hold the appointment? Do you call the mom (if they

miss the appointment) and reschedule and tack on a fee for missing

the first one? I am not sure how to manage this problem, and niether

is my partner. I know Dr's offices and dentists will charge for

missed appointments, but they also generally already have the clients

info on file and just add it to the fess they charge anyway. We are

talking about moms who have just called to make an appointment and

then dont show. I have had 3 no shows this week alone (things happen

in 3's, maybe that'll be it?). I dont want to lose the mom's

business by putting them off by asking for a deposit, but I cant keep

losing business by them not showing up and me not taking other

clients during thier schedules appointment time, YKWIM??

Any ideas or insights are appreciaeted!
